Philippine minister slams China with expletive; Xi Jinping urges deterrence against the west

China in Focus
China in Focus
The Chinese Communist Party leader is pushing for more military deterrence. In a speech, he claimed China has the upper hand amid the current global situation. The world’s biggest power players are debating how to deal with China. America’s top diplomat is making his position clear. The Pentagon is calling for a "new vision" for U-S defense. It’s top official says the country should use technology to address threats from China. The Philippines’ Foreign Minister seems to have had enough. He told China to "get out" in a Twitter post, complete with vulgar language. This as Chinese ships continuously show up in Filipino waters. And the sea level is rising along China’s coast. A number of cities could be at risk, including financial hub Shanghai. New reports disclose the unusual reason why.
